PUBLIC SERVICE ANNOUNCEMENT – DOMESTIC VIOLENCE EVENT
ULSTER COUNTY DISTRICT ATTORNEY TO HELP RAISE MONEY FOR DV
SHELTER
On average, twenty four people per minute are victims of
rape, physical violence or stalking by an intimate partner in the United
States, more than twelve million women and men over the course of a year.
District Attorney Holley Carnright will be hosting a
fundraising event on September 10, 2015 at one of Ulster County’s premier
venues, the Headless Horseman in Esopus.
All proceeds will be donated to the Washbourne House, Ulster County’s
only domestic violence shelter.
“We had put together a dynamic team anticipating my 2015
campaign for re-election. When we
learned that I will not have an opponent, we kicked around the idea of using
our combined energies to try and help victims of domestic violence. I learned recently that the shelter has lost
a $50,000.00 grant which was critical to the services they provide and they are
really scrambling for money” stated Carnright.
“I see firsthand the
effects and consequences of domestic violence and felt strongly that this was a
perfect time to give something back to our community” said Holley Carnright,
District Attorney of Ulster County. “I hope
everyone will come out and support this event.
Our goal is to raise $10,000.00 to help with therapeutic and operational
costs of the Washbourne House.”
“When a woman and her children come to the shelter, they
quite literally have nothing but the clothing they are wearing. We provide them, not only essentials: food, clothing, toiletries, but also
counselling and emotional comfort” stated Michael Berg, Director of the Family
of Woodstock.
